Bulletins are a form of communication akin to targeted, bite-sized public service announcements (PSA) meant to deliver relevant information and training to workers – usually via mobile devices – in the moments when the information has maximum value. Bulletins can be simple text or media rich, real-time or scheduled, require a follow up action or just require opening and sent to an specific group or sent in mass. The key differentiator, however, is that bulletins allow the sender to monitor the engagement of the receiving group: Did everyone see the bulletin? When? How did they respond if they had multiple response options?
